RESEARCH ALERT - Networking stocks downgraded
Reuters, Tuesday, February 11, 1997 at 15:47
-- First Albany said it downgraded the computer networking group. -- Said 3Com Corps (NASDAQ:COMS) profit warning Monday raised "significant questions about near-term growth of networking. -- "Investment momentum in group has stalled," a report from analyst Matt Barzowskas said. -- The firm lowered Cabletron Systems Inc (NYSE:CS), 3Com, Cisco Systems Inc (NASDAQ:CSCO), Ascend Communications Inc (NASDAQ:ASND), Shiva Corp (NASDAQ:SHVA), U.S. Robotics Corp (NASDAQ:USRX) and Xircom Inc (NASDAQ:XIRC) to neutral from buy. -- Maintained Bay Networks Inc (NYSE:BAY) at neutral.
